In Case of Emergency: A Water Shut-Off Valve’s Significance and Locations
The plumbing system of your home is a detailed network of pipes and also shut-off valves. In the event of an emergency, you can reduce the water using the valves.

Why Must I Bother with This?



Expert servicemen will certainly shut off these valves when there are repair services in local lines. For example, your restroom sink is damaged, so you can readily discover the shut-off shutoff beneath the sink. However, for significant leakages, you must close the mainline shut-off valve. If you will certainly be away for getaway, it is likewise excellent technique to turn this off.

The longer you wait to close the shut-off shutoff, the extra considerable the damages will certainly be. You might not have adequate time to figure out just how to close the shutoffs when you're panicking among an emergency.

What Does the Shut-Off Shutoff Resemble?



This is normally a handle that allows you to switch off the water for a specific appliance, a localized area (for example the whole second floor), or for the entire building. It is vital to recognize where these shutoffs are, so when something surface in any area of your residence, you can shut it right away. This will aid you avoid significant water damage that will cost thousands to fix.

    How Do I Find My Water Shut Off Valve?


    Check inside your house first. If your home has a basement or crawlspace, the shut off valve is probably located on a wall near the front of your house. If your home is built on a slab, check in the garage or near the water heater for the shut off valve.



    Next, check outside your house. If the water main shut off valve is located outside, it will be buried underground near the street. Look for a round or rectangular metal cover flush with the grass or sidewalk. It might be labeled “water meter” to help you identify it. Under this cover is the water shut off valve.


    How to Turn Off the Main Water Line


    If the valve is located inside, turn it clockwise to shut off the water supply to your home. You shouldn’t require any tools – simply turn the valve by hand.



    If the valve is located outside, you may need special tools to open the water meter cover. In most cases, a pentagon socket wrench is required to remove a security bolt holding the cover in place. If the bolt isn’t recessed, you may be able to turn it with a simple pair of pliers. Some covers feature a “key hole” that can only be opened with a meter key. Then, other covers lift off with no tools needed – just give the lid a twist.



    With the cover removed, look inside and locate the residential water supply shut off valve (the one positioned closest to your house). Turning off the valve requires special tools. Most likely, you’ll need a meter key. If there’s room, you can probably twist the valve with an adjustable wrench. Your underground valve may look as though it could be turned by hand, but if it hasn’t moved in years, don’t count on it.



    Whatever tools you use, turn the shut off valve clockwise all the way to bring the water flow to a standstill.


    How to Shut Off Other Water Valves


    When minor plumbing problems strike, you don’t need to shut off the water to the whole house –simply turn the valve behind the appliance or fixture that’s giving you trouble. The primary water shut off valves you should know about are located:



    Behind the washing machine: If the washer hose starts leaking or the appliance overflows, limit water damage by pulling the unit away from the wall and turning the shut off valve behind it clockwise.



    By the toilet: Whether your toilet is overflowing or you need to replace a leaky flapper, stop the flow of water by turning the shut off valve (located on the wall behind the toilet) clockwise.



    Under the sink: Before you repair or replace a faucet, turn off the water supply. You’ve got the hang of it now – twist the water shut off valve under the sink clockwise.
